Abstract

The invention relates to a multi-antenna assembly which comprises at least one first antenna unit arranged on the same side of a first mounting bottom plate, first feeders electrically connected with the first antenna units, and feeder isolators arranged at the peripheries of the first feeders to avoid signal interference. In order to avoid feeder interference to inter-layer antenna units, the feeder isolators are arranged to improve the degree of antenna isolation.

technical field [0001] The invention relates to the field of wireless communication equipment, and more specifically relates to an omnidirectional multi-antenna component and its wireless equipment. Background technique [0002] In the wireless communication system, users have requirements for continuous improvement of data throughput, high QoS service quality and strong anti-interference ability of the wireless communication system. For example, in communication systems such as IEEE802.11a / g / n, a wireless access point (AP) transmits data to and from one or more wireless user equipment through a wireless link. The wireless UE may be susceptible to other access points, other wireless communication devices, changes or interference in the wireless link environment between the access point and the remote receiving point, and the like.
